你查询的IP:[116.4.223.196]  地理位置:中国–广东–东莞

最新查询121.51.72.125 116.116.100.93 122.96.98.155 123.52.250.7 159.226.223.180 117.57.234.73 117.100.233.241 121.16.169.108 120.24.157.139 116.4.223.196 202.170.128.127 202.38.176.14 218.108.97.206 118.67.112.17 202.38.149.246 202.136.48.5 124.20.84.212 161.207.180.144 58.240.100.235 116.13.81.19 117.75.248.19 58.87.64.205 202.143.16.121 120.219.5.50 221.8.82.131 221.13.213.105 203.207.128.198 116.193.32.49 60.253.128.149 117.8.32.181 202.4.252.236